Lookout Tower, Ardmore
A view of the Lookout Tower, Ardmore. This tower was built during the Napoleonic wars to act as an early warning system if the French tried to invade Ireland.

The Gable Of Ardmore Cathedral
The arcading outer face of the west wall of the cathedral at Ardmore photographed at night. Note a number of the top panels are blank but the remaining panels depict the Archangel Michael weighing the souls. Adam and Eve are depicted in the lower left panel. The Adoration of the Maji and the Judgement of Solomon are depicted lower right.
